  14. [] Bad news for ya barry, times have changed. Petrol is no longer cheaper in France. Unleaded 95 is about the same price as in the U.K. so i would assume V power would be the same LPG is now about 10% more expensive in Calais. Diesel is about 15% cheaper. And unbelivably Petrol in Belgium is now more expensive than both France and the U.K. Just to keep you informed, buying petrol on the autoroutes is expensive about 10% more than the hypermarkets, so i'd stick to the hypermarkets.
